﻿@charset "utf-8";
.may{
	padding:0px;
	font-size:13px;
	font-family:Arial, Helvetica, sans-serif;
	line-height:18px;
	color:#555554;
	}
.may .top{
	display:block;
	width:715px;
	float:left;
	}
.may .bottom{
	width:715px;
	float:left;
	}
.may .contbg01{
	background:url(../images/six/img01c.jpg) left repeat-y;
	width:715px;
	float:left;
	}
.may .contbg_b01{
	background:url(../images/six/img01d.jpg) left bottom no-repeat;
	padding:10px 70px 0px 50px ;
 	}/*100722修正*/
.may .contbg_t01{
	background:url(../images/six/img01h.jpg) left top no-repeat;
	width:715px;
	float:left;
	}
.may .contbg02{
	background:url(../images/six/img02c.jpg) left repeat-y;
	width:715px;
	float:left;	
	}
.may .contbg_b02{
	background:url(../images/six/img02d.jpg) left bottom no-repeat;
	padding:10px 70px 10px 50px ;
	height:1420px;
 	}
.may .contbg_t02{
	background:url(../images/six/img02h.jpg) left top no-repeat;
	width:715px;
	float:left;
	}	
.may .contbg03{
	background:url(../images/six/img03c.jpg) left repeat-y;
	width:715px;
	float:left;
	}
.may .contbg03 a{
	color:#df4f4f;
	text-decoration:underline;
	outline:none;/* for Firefox */
	hlbr:expression(this.onFocus=this.blur());/* for IE */ 
	}
.may .contbg03 a:visited{
	color:#df4f4f;
	text-decoration:underline;
	}	
.may .contbg03 a:hover{
	color:#555554;
	text-decoration: none;
	}
.may .contbg_b03{
	background:url(../images/six/img03d.jpg) left bottom no-repeat;
	padding:10px 70px 10px 50px ;
	height:1600px;
 	}
.may .contbg_t03{
	background:url(../images/six/img03h.jpg) left top no-repeat;
	width:715px;
	float:left;
	}
.may .contbg04{
	background:url(../images/six/img04c.jpg) left repeat-y;
	width:715px;
	float:left;
	}
.may .contbg_b04{
	background:url(../images/six/img04d.jpg) left bottom no-repeat;
	padding:10px 70px 10px 50px ;
	height:350px;
 	}
.may .contbg_t04{
	background:url(../images/six/img04h.jpg) left top no-repeat;
	width:715px;
	float:left;
	}	
.may .contbg05{
	background:url(../images/six/img05c.jpg) left repeat-y;
	width:715px;
	float:left;
	}
.may .contbg_b05{
	background:url(../images/six/img05d.jpg) left bottom no-repeat;
	padding:10px 70px 10px 50px ;
	height:500px;
 	}
.may .contbg_t05{
	background:url(../images/six/img05h.jpg) left top no-repeat;
	width:715px;
	float:left;
	}
.may .contbg06{
	background:url(../images/six/img06c.jpg) left repeat-y;
	width:715px;
	float:left;
	}
.may .contbg06 a{
	color:#df4f4f;
	text-decoration:underline;
	outline:none;/* for Firefox */
	hlbr:expression(this.onFocus=this.blur());/* for IE */ 
	}
.may .contbg06 a:visited{
	color:#df4f4f;
	text-decoration:underline;
	}	
.may .contbg06 a:hover{
	color:#555554;
	text-decoration: none;
	}
.may .contbg_b06{
	background:url(../images/six/img06d.jpg) left bottom no-repeat;
	padding:10px 70px 10px 50px ;
	height:860px;
 	}
.may .contbg_t06{
	background:url(../images/six/img06h.jpg) left top no-repeat;
	width:715px;
	float:left;
	}
.may h1{
	line-height:22px;
	font-size:15px;
	color:#733e04;
	font-weight:bold;
	padding-bottom:5px;
	}
.may h2{
	padding-left:8px;
	}
.may h3{
	line-height:22px;
	padding-top:15px;
	font-size:13px;
	color:#9d5c16;
	}
.may h4{
	line-height:22px;
	padding:10px 0 15px 0;
	color:#a6a6a6;
	letter-spacing:2px;
	width:595px;
	}
.may h5{
	padding:0 0 8px 0;
	font-size:13px;
	}
.may h6{
	color:#df7554;
	}
.may ul{
	margin:0 0 5px 0;
	padding:0px;
	text-align:left;
	}
.may li{
	border:0px;
	margin:0 0 0 18px;
	*margin:0 0 0 24px;
	padding-bottom:7px;
	list-style-type: decimal;
	}
.may li a{
	color:#555554;
	text-decoration:underline;
	outline:none;/* for Firefox */
	hlbr:expression(this.onFocus=this.blur());/* for IE */ 
	}
.may li a:visited{
	color:#555554;
	text-decoration:underline;
	}	
.may li a:hover{
	color:#df4f4f;
	text-decoration: none;
	}
.may_font_gray{
	color:#408243;
	}
.may .pic{
	width:620px;
	float:left;
	}
.may .pic01{
	width:620px;
	padding-top:15px;
	padding-bottom:15px;
	float:left;
	}
.may .img{
	width:590px;
	padding:40px 0 0 0;
	float:left;
	}
.may .img01{
	padding:3px;
	margin:3px 0 10px 0;
	border:1px solid #c0c0c0;
	}
.may .img02{
	padding:3px;
	margin:7px 0 15px 0;
	border:1px solid #c0c0c0;
	}
.may .font01{
	color:#d60000;
	font-size:13px;
	}
.may .font02{
	color:#d60000;
	}
.may .font03{
	font-size:16px;
	*font-size:12px;
	padding-right:5px;
	}	

/* 清除文繞圖 */
.may_end{
	clear:both;
	font-size:0;
	}

/* 右側 */	
#rightbut{
	width:230px;
	float:left;
	margin-bottom:10px;
	}
#rightContent  #hot #hotMore {
	position: absolute;
	z-index: 1;
	display: block;
	height: 16px;
	width: 40px;
	top: 15px;
	right: 41px;
}
#rightContent #hot ul {
	width: 200px;
}
#rightContent #subBanner {
	display: block;
	height: 195px;
	width: 230px;
	overflow: hidden;
	clear: both;
	margin-bottom: 10px;
}
#rightContent #subBanner li {
	margin-bottom: 10px;
	display: block;
	height: 58px;
	width: 230px;
	overflow: hidden;
	position: relative;
}
